gxcnvip 发表于 2012-2-10 14:13:21

关于上传文件问题,请高手指教

下面代码是我写的上传图片代码,但是总是上传不了,什么问题?请各位高手指教。

//上传附件
      $config['upload_path'] = 'uploads/'.date('Ym').'/';
      /*if (!is_dir($config['upload_path'])){
            @mk_dir($config['upload_path'], 0777);
      }*/
      $config['allowed_types'] = 'gif|jpg|png';
      $config['max_size'] = '100';
      $config['max_width']= '1024';
      $config['max_height']= '768';
      $config['file_name']= $this->input->post('image');
      $config['encrypt_name']= TRUE;

      $this->load->library('upload', $config);
      
      if ( ! $this->upload->do_upload()) {
            $error = array('error' => $this->upload->display_errors());
      } else {
            $data['image'] = $this->upload->file_name;
            $data['path'] = $config['upload_path'];
      }

huboo82 发表于 2012-2-10 15:06:00

有 type="file" 的 input,记得 form 要这样

<form action="" method="post" enctype="multipart/form-data"></form>

gxcnvip 发表于 2012-2-10 16:30:30

huboo82 发表于 2012-2-10 15:06 static/image/common/back.gif
有 type="file" 的 input,记得 form 要这样

这样写也不行,奇怪了。

我是看着手册学的。。

Hex 发表于 2012-2-10 16:38:13

gxcnvip 发表于 2012-2-10 16:30 static/image/common/back.gif
这样写也不行,奇怪了。

我是看着手册学的。。

报什么错最重要

gxcnvip 发表于 2012-2-10 16:44:20

本帖最后由 gxcnvip 于 2012-2-10 17:00 编辑

Hex 发表于 2012-2-10 16:38 static/image/common/back.gif
报什么错最重要
什么错误都没报,数据库也保存不到图片名


我单独写一个上传的页面就可以上传,我想知道,我把代码放在保存文章的代码里面为什么就不行了?

Hex 发表于 2012-2-10 17:03:42

gxcnvip 发表于 2012-2-10 16:44 static/image/common/back.gif
什么错误都没报,数据库也保存不到图片名




没报错就不好办了。
你把代码都打包发上来吧。

gxcnvip 发表于 2012-2-10 17:15:56

本帖最后由 gxcnvip 于 2012-2-10 18:29 编辑

麻烦你帮我看看,谢谢了

gxcnvip 发表于 2012-2-10 18:16:20

Hex 发表于 2012-2-10 17:03 static/image/common/back.gif
没报错就不好办了。
你把代码都打包发上来吧。

我已经打包了,麻烦你帮看看,谢谢了

gxcnvip 发表于 2012-2-10 18:27:03

解决了。。

Hex 发表于 2012-2-10 19:11:30

gxcnvip 发表于 2012-2-10 18:27 static/image/common/back.gif
解决了。。

怎么回事?
页: [1] 2
查看完整版本: 关于上传文件问题,请高手指教